    Re: Connecting - (Oxycut + Mach3 + Pronest )

    Huh? How about you start with the manuals? On the CandCNC.Com website Manuals Page. Depending on the CandCNC product you have, there are two Aux relays to turn on anything you want. They are controlled though MACH3 using M07; M08 and M09.
